What are the steps for jump-starting a car?

Steps for jump-starting a car: 1. Prepare two jumper cables and a vehicle that can supply power; 2. Remove the buckle of the battery box to open the battery protective cover, exposing the positive and negative terminals of the battery. Both the rescue vehicle and the vehicle being rescued should operate on the battery while the engine is off; 3. Identify the positive and negative terminals of the battery. If you cannot distinguish them, avoid connecting them randomly; 4. Take one jumper cable, connect one end to the positive terminal of the dead battery and the other end to the positive terminal of the live battery. Ensure the positive and negative terminals do not touch, as this could cause a short circuit; 5. Take the other jumper cable, first connect it to the negative terminal of the live battery, then connect the other end to the engine block or body of the dead vehicle. Avoid connecting negative to negative; 6. After connecting the cables, start the live vehicle to provide a reliable voltage to the dead vehicle; 7. Once the dead vehicle starts and is powered by its alternator, the jumper cables can be removed—first disconnect the negative cable, then the positive cable.
